New York, NY Manhattan Theatre Club (Lynne Meadow, Artistic Director; Barry Grove, Executive Producer) has announced the lineup for its 25th annual Ted Snowdon Reading Series, which will begin on Monday, March 6. Readings will be held on Mondays through March 27 at New York City Center – Stage I (131 West 55th Street). All readings are free and open to the public, but space is limited and RSVPs are required. The Ted Snowdon Reading Series is dedicated to the support and development of innovative new work, offering each playwright a week-long rehearsal period with directors and actors. This year, the series will feature four new plays, including one MTC commission*.

March 6 at 4pm: The Heart Sellers by Lloyd Suh, directed by May Adrales

March 13 at 4pm: As Above by Christine Quintana

March 20 at 4pm: Watch Me by Dave Harris

March 27 at 4pm: An Oxford Man by Else Went, directed by Emma Rosa Went*
